9.2 Inspection of the oil mist detector (16,000 hours or after 24 months)
To ensure that the device is in proper working condition, defined maintenance and
inspection work must be carried out by authorised and instructed specialist personnel.
In this case, an inspection by a Schaller service partner is required after
16,000 operating hours or after 24 months. See Section 12 (
Section 12 Contact) in hits
manual for suitable partners or go to https://schaller-automation.com/en/partners/.
